Kasper Niehausartist • painterGroningen 1889-1974 Bergen (N.H.)

biography of Kasper Niehaus

Kasper Niehaus painted portraits and landscapes with figures in a highly recognisable style. His forms are outlined and rigidly stylised, the colours light and wispy, the figures and setting brought together in a well-considered composition emanating peace and harmony. Niehaus was also an art critic and through his contributions and his book 'Levende Nederlandsche Kunst' (Living Dutch Art) endeavoured to take a stand for modern painting.
